This one turned out to be one of the best briskets I ever cooked. Cooked it really low (200) overnight an then bumped the temp up this morning. Pulled it off after 16 hours and an internal of 195. Separated the point and flat. Put the flat in a cooler and put the point back on the cooker for another hour for burnt ends.

The burnt ends turned out great and the flat sliced perfectly!!! The slices were moist and such great beef flavor. Man I love brisket. Only problem is we had family over after church and it is pretty much gone. I may have enough left for one small sammich
